Legal Rule: 24/7 Service Allowed

Arizona law is clear: process servers are legally allowed to serve documents any time of day or night, every day of the year. There are no statutory restrictions against serving at late hours.

Despite this wide legal window, most process servers choose more practical hours to balance effectiveness and courtesy.

Most Common Serving Hours: 6 AM to 10 PM

Even though overnight service is lawful, the most successful and respectful window is between 6:00 AM and 10:00 PM. This period allows for meaningful contact while avoiding night-time disruptions.

Why these hours work best:

  • People are more likely to be awake and present
  • Service feels less intrusive
  • Your affidavit of service looks more reasonable in court

What If Someone Is Avoiding Service?

If avoidance becomes an issue, process servers may:

  • Return at unpredictable times, including early mornings or later evenings
  • Recommend stake-out or scheduled attempts to catch the person when available
  • As a last resort, file for alternative service methods, with court approval

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

Is midnight serving allowed in Arizona?

Yes, legally valid, but rarely used due to effectiveness and courtesy concerns.

Can someone request not to be served late at night?

You can request, but it doesn’t guarantee the server’s compliance, though professionals may avoid those hours for respect.

Do other states restrict late-night service?

Many states do. Arizona stands out for allowing 24/7 service.
